Elderly sh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ing shower setups to enhance safety, accessibility, and comfort for seniors. These services typically include the installation of walk-in showers, low-threshold or barrier-free designs, grab bars,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for individuals with limited mobility or balance issues. Professionals may also customize shower features to accommodate specific needs, such as seating options or handheld showerheads, ensuring the space is both functional and user-friendly.

This service addresses common challenges faced by elderly individuals when using traditional showers. Standard shower setups can pose hazards like high thresholds, slippery surfaces, and the absence of supportive fixtures, which can lead to accidents or discomfort. Elderly shower installation helps solve these problems by transforming existing bathrooms into safer, more accessible spaces. It can also assist caregivers by making bathing routines easier and more manageable, contributing to a more independent lifestyle for seniors while reducing the potential for injuries.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Garden Ridge,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ing an elderly shower typ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the shower type and existing bathroom setup. Basic models may be on the lower end, while customized or accessible designs tend to be more expensive. Local service providers can provide specific estimates based on individual needs.

Material Expenses - Material costs for elderly shower installations can vary from $500 to $2,500. This includes the shower unit, grab bars, seating, and other accessibility features. Premium materials or specialized fixtures may increase the overall expense.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ing an elderly shower generally fall between $500 and $2,000. Rates depend on the complexity of the installation and the local market rates in areas like Garden Ridge, TX. Experienced contractors can provide detailed quotes after assessing the site.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as plumbing modifications or waterproofing might add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These costs vary based on existing bathroom conditions and specific accessibility requirements. Consulting local pros can help clarify potential additional exp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ing an elderly-friendly shower? An elderly-friendly shower can enhance safety, reduce fall risks, and provide easier access for individuals with mobility challenges.

What features are typically included in elderly shower installations? Features may include low-threshold or curbless designs,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ring.

How long does a typical elderly shower installation take? Installation times can vary depending on the project scope, but generally, it may take several hours to a full day.

Are there specific materials recommended for elderly shower setups? Non-slip tiles, waterproof seating, and durable, easy-to-clean fixtures are commonly recommended for safety and convenience.
